Output 03ab73342a71ef0dbb196698ca2615546a7c25d9e56ef74e81b1dd5db69dff69:0

value
2808212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d86fa8d3b7546b3bf30f4921c86ab9bb99ba28 OP_EQUAL
address
3MTbAEAifhTHNFgcqoS6dBfseo6nU6EQkh
transaction
03ab73342a71ef0dbb196698ca2615546a7c25d9e56ef74e81b1dd5db69dff69
spent
true